Synonyms and Antonyms of rack up

synonym (synonym of rack up)

  • (verb.competition)
    hit, score, tally
    gain points in a game (verb.competition)
     
  • (verb.competition)
    mop up, pip, whip, worst
    defeat thoroughly (verb.competition)
